Output a73876823bc5a2fa954faae93332e00a9d2ad9bf6cb7e15071ae3fd70ee47412:20

value
20978752795
script pubkey
OP_0 OP_PUSHBYTES_20 08da93bfad48bddcdaf49e65248c3195a1838caa
address
bc1qprdf80adfz7aekh5nejjfrp3jksc8r929svpxk
transaction
a73876823bc5a2fa954faae93332e00a9d2ad9bf6cb7e15071ae3fd70ee47412
confirmations
138667
spent
true